Table 1 Characteristics of participants according to Generalized Anxiety Disorder-7 score, represented by medians and interquartile range
Variable | Total (n = 655) | GAD-7 score < 9 (n = 585) | GAD-7 score ≥ 9 (n = 70) | P value |
Age (yr) | 30 (26-47) | 31 (26-49) | 27 (23-33) | < 0.001 |
Gender | 0.007 | |||
Male | 246 (37.6%) | 230 (39.3%) | 16 (22.9%) | |
Female | 409 (62.4%) | 355 (60.7%) | 54 (77.1%) | |
Number of children | 0.008 | |||
Zero | 392 (59.8%) | 336 (57.4%) | 56 (80.0%) | |
One | 37 (5.6%) | 34 (5.8%) | 3 (4.3%) | |
Two | 95 (14.5%) | 91 (15.6%) | 4 (5.7%) | |
Three | 100 (15.3%) | 94 (16.1%) | 6 (8.6%) | |
Four | 31 (4.7%) | 30 (5.1%) | 1 (1.4%) | |
Education | 0.003 | |||
Without diploma | 23 (3.5%) | 21 (3.6%) | 2 (2.9%) | |
12 years or less | 125 (19.1%) | 102 (17.4%) | 23 (32.9%) | |
Bachelor | 295 (45.0%) | 260 (44.4%) | 35 (50.0%) | |
Master (or higher) | 187 (28.5%) | 178 (30.4%) | 9 (12.9%) | |
Other | 25 (3.8%) | 24 (4.1%) | 1 (1.4%) | |
Socio-economic status | < 0.001 | |||
Low | 21 (3.2%) | 16 (2.7%) | 5 (7.1%) | |
Low-average | 79 (2.1%) | 60 (10.3%) | 19 (27.1%) | |
Average | 281 (42.9%) | 252 (43.1%) | 29 (41.1%) | |
Average-high | 224 (34.2%) | 209 (35.7%) | 15 (21.4%) | |
High | 50 (7.6%) | 48 (8.2%) | 2 (2.9%) | |
Occupation | 0.029 | |||
Full-time job | 280 (42.7%) | 261 (44.6%) | 19 (27.1%) | |
Partially employed | 109 (16.6%) | 90 (15.4%) | 19 (27.1%) | |
Unpaid vacation | 4 (0.6%) | 4 (0.7%) | 0 (0.0%) | |
Lost job | 33 (5.0%) | 31 (5.3%) | 2 (2.9%) | |
Unemployed | 55 (8.4%) | 47 (8.0%) | 8 (11.4%) | |
Retired | 174 (26.6%) | 152 (26.0%) | 22 (31.4%) | |
Exercise | 0.112 | |||
Yes | 190 (29.0%) | 164 (28.0%) | 26 (37.1%) | |
No | 465 (71.0%) | 421 (72.0%) | 44 (62.9%) | |
History of depression | < 0.001 | |||
Yes | 538 (82.1%) | 494 (84.4%) | 44 (62.9%) | |
No | 117 (17.9%) | 91 (15.6%) | 26 (37.1%) | |
Use of antidepressants | 0.001 | |||
Yes | 563 (86.0%) | 512 (87.5%) | 51 (72.9%) | |
No | 92 (14.0%) | 73 (12.5%) | 19 (27.1%) | |
MSPSS score | 6.08 (5.25-6.67) | 6.08 (5.33-6.75) | 5.75 (4.67-6.50) | 0.009 |
GAD-7 score | 3 (1-6) | 3 (1-5) | 13 (11-15) | < 0.001 |
Table 2 Associations of Generalized Anxiety Disorder-7 score with Multidimensional Perceived Social Support Scale score (regression coefficient and 95% confidence intervals)
Variable | Univariate linear regression | Multivariate linear regression | ||
β (95%CI) | P value | β (95%CI) | P value | |
MSPSS | -0.692 (-0.990, -0.394) | < 0.001 | -0.779 (-1.063, -0.496) | < 0.001 |
Age | -0.056 (-0.077, -0.035) | < 0.001 | -0.048 (-0.068, -0.028) | < 0.001 |
Sex | 1.888 (1.246, 2.529) | 0.316 | 1.641 (1.021, 2.261) | < 0.001 |
Number of children | -0.524 (-0.760, -0.289) | < 0.001 | - | - |
Education | -0.399 (-0.763, -0.034) | 0.032 | - | - |
Occupation | 0.142 (-0.006, 0.289) | 0.059 | - | - |
Socio-economic status | -0.952 (-1.300, -0.603) | < 0.001 | -0.514 (-0.854, -0.174) | 0.003 |
Exercise | -0.460 (-1.162, 0.241) | 0.198 | - | - |
Use of antidepressants | 2.589 (1.781, 3.397) | < 0.001 | 2.046 (1.279, 2.813) | < 0.001 |
Table 3 Odds ratios (95% confidence intervals) of anxiety (Generalized Anxiety Disorder-7 score ≥ 9) across Multidimensional Perceived Social Support Scale score
Variable | Univariate logistic regression | Multivariate logistic regression | ||
OR (95%CI) | P value | OR (95%CI) | P value | |
MSPSS | 0.747 (0.605, 0.921) | 0.006 | 0.709 (0.563, 0.894) | 0.004 |
Age | 0.965 (0.944, 0.986) | 0.001 | 0.976 (0.953, 0.999) | 0.041 |
Sex | 2.187 (1.222, 3.913) | 0.008 | 2.151 (1.142, 4.053) | 0.018 |
Number of children | 0.658 (0.514, 0.842) | 0.001 | - | - |
Education | 0.617 (0.464, 0.822) | 0.001 | 0.615 (0.445, 0.851) | 0.003 |
Occupation | 1.096 (0.980, 1.227) | 0.109 | - | - |
Socio-economic status | 0.539 (0.409, 0.710) | < 0.001 | 0.628 (0.465, 0.849) | 0.003 |
Exercise | 0.659 (0.393, 1.106) | 0.114 | - | - |
Use of antidepressants | 2.613 (1.461, 4.672) | 0.001 | 2.588 (1.384, 4.841) | 0.004 |
